Factors Influencing Cost
Marble tile repair in Palm Harbor, FL, involves restoring damaged or worn marble surfaces to their original appearance. The scope of work can vary based on the extent of damage, size of the area, and specific project requirements. Understanding typical project considerations can help in comparing options and estimating costs for marble tile repair services.
- Materials: Repair may involve matching existing marble, epoxy fillers, or sealants to ensure a seamless finish.
- Size and Scope: Small cracks or chips may require minimal repair, while larger sections might involve extensive work or replacement.
- Labor Complexity: Repairs can range from straightforward patching to intricate color matching and polishing, affecting labor time and skill level.
- Permitting: Typically, minor repairs do not require permits, but extensive renovations or structural work may need local approval.
- Additional Services: Options such as polishing, sealing, or surface refinishing can be included to enhance durability and appearance after repairs.
